I can't find music disc 11 and I'm new to the game and the forums. I looked on the shroom island and it wasn't there. In tutorial mode. Tu11
Unfortuantely, if you loaded your world in Peaceful before you explored the mushroom island that particular chest does not generate. This was intentionally coded that way by 4J to encourage people to stay in Easy or higher diffuculty levels until at least exploring some terrain outside of the immediate tutorial area.

Back when the chests were first hidden in any tutorial, the stipulation that a person had to stay within the tutorial mode was revealed by 4J. You can see several references to it on many of the hidden chest videos made for those first and second times the chests were put into the tutorial. I'm not sure if any of the people doing vides for this last round of hidden chests bothered to mention it or not... They may have assumed that it was just known by everyone by now.
However, the tutorial never starts/creates itself on peaceful. If you've last saved a world in peaceful and then you start a tutorial, the setting defaults to easy. However, after the tutorial itself has been completed and you save the world, it may reload on a setting you've just used for another world just before reloading the tutorial one. It really pays to carefully read what the load screen is saying each time before you load a world to make sure that you don't load it in a difficulty level you don't actually intend to load it in.
You can still acquired "11" by getting a skeleton to kill a creeper. I have obtained all 12 music discs/records by having skeletons kill creepers, so they are all available in any world that way.

In the last 10 minutes, I just tested it: Created a new tutorial, pressed B to short-circuit the tutorial, ate my steak, and sprinted over to the mushroom island. The chest was there; however, you should be aware that the music disc in that particular chest is not "11"... It's "where are we now." I think now it is most likely that it is a different chest that you haven't found yet in your oriiginal tutorial world.
